WebSubcooling and refrigeration cycle optimizers. All previous systems produce an economizer effect by using compressors, meters, valves and heat exchangers within the refrigeration cycle. Depending on the system, in some refrigeration cycles it may be convenient to produce the economizer using an independent refrigeration mechanism. WebThe economizer cycle also tends to reduce the overall refrigerant flowrate by 6-10% of the standard cycle flow rate. These two benefits combine to make the cycle more efficient, as well as potentially increasing the capacity of the chiller if the standard flow rate is still used.
